Handover: DeployBot (Perchline)

Bot posts deploy status to the release channel. Known flake: status messages lag ~2 min when Quarrel CI is under load — not an outage, don't restart it. If it goes fully silent, bounce the `perchline-bot` pod and check the webhook queue. Restart steps and queue dashboard are on the page below.

runbook for badug-kadup: https://confluence.zemvarlabs.internal/projects/browse/display/projects/bd1b

Memo — Hartwick Components

To: Incoming Director

Flagging a risk: 61% of revenue comes from one account, Penrow Systems. Their renewal lands in Q2. Loss would force plant consolidation at Ellsworth. Diversification efforts to date have underperformed. Mitigation options and our intended course are outlined in the confidential note appended below.

confidential, fafog-fafog: Only 21 of the 82 pilot accounts renewed Holwyn, so a churn review is set for September 1. Normirox Logistics is in early talks to buy Praiusox Foods for about $134.2 million.

**OPS-7731: Compactor creds expired on Quillstream**

Heads up, on-call friend: the log compaction worker for Quillstream (our message queue) stopped compacting segments last night because its service credentials quietly expired. Disk usage on the broker nodes is creeping up — nothing urgent yet, but give it a day and we'll be paging about storage. The fix is easy: restart the compactor with refreshed credentials and confirm segment counts start dropping. Use the replacement key below when you restart it.

service key, tadup-tahog: zpat7_wB1tnEL